dc.description.abstract<p>Renewables-based Neo-Carbon Vision of the world in 2050 portrays an electrified, resilient and secure society with empowered, prosumeristic citizens who upload their surplus energy into smart grids as well as download energy when needed. The following overview on key insights of the Neo-Carbon Energy project on energy futures helps to frame the academic and societal discourse in the years to come.</p><p>Four scenarios assume a social perspective to open up very different avenues as transformative manifestations of this vision. The vision shows the preferred goal – a renewables-based society – while the scenarios outline alternative expressions and pathways towards the desired vision. Finally, the actors that can make this change happen have to be identified and supported, especially in policy-making, and the role of energy markets re-thought.<br /></p><div><br /></div>
